zoukankan      html  css  js  c++  java
  • JS初学之-循环生成坐标

    <!doctype html>
    <html>
    <head>
    <meta charset="utf-8">
    <title>无标题文档</title>
    <style>
    div{background:url(img/79.jpg);position:absolute}
    </style>
    <script>
    window.onload=function(){
    var oDiv=document.getElementById('div1');
    var aDiv=oDiv.getElementsByTagName('div');
    var arr = [ 'red', 'yellow', 'blue' ];

    var str = '';
    for( var i=0; i<6; i++){
    for ( var j=0; j<10; j++){
    str+="<div style='background-position:"+ (-j*48) +'px '+(-i*50)+"px;50px;height:50px;position:absolute;top:"+i*52+"px;left:"+j*52+"px;'></div>";
    };
    };
    oDiv.innerHTML=str;

    //横向6排,纵向10排,每次在执行完一次外面的循环后条件满足就会执行里面的循环,里面的循环的DIV要想实现横向布局就需要定位,top值是i,left值是j.
    //算好每张图片需要背景定位的数值。

    };
    </script>
    </head>

    <body>
    <div id="div1"></div>
    </body>
    </html>

  • 相关阅读:
    jquery---stop()
    标准设备的-media queries
    CSS3 Media Queries
    css---------selector
    sublime----(1)
    XAMPP、WAMP、appserv
    Express.js----路由
    nodejs----上传显示图片
    node.js-----处理POST请求
    DotNetOpenAuth使用笔记
  • 原文地址:https://www.cnblogs.com/aomore/p/4031290.html
Copyright © 2011-2022 走看看